Martha’s Tacos and More sits in a parking lot right off the main drag in Lafayette. The restaurant itself is housed in a nondescript building that you’d probably drive right by if there wasn’t a sign on the street. The interior of Martha’s Tacos is not much either but it is clean. What Martha’s lacks in décor it more than makes up for in food quality. The staff is friendly, humorous, and very accommodating. Tacos go for $ 1.75 and you have your choice of meats. Interestingly, ground beef was not one of the taco meat selections. Complete meals including rice and beans cost $ 7.95. Seafood selections go for $ 8.95. The tortillas at Martha’s are handmade, doughy, and absolutely delicious. Martha’s tomato salsa is outstanding. One interesting concept at Martha’s Tacos is the«Wet Burrito» and the«Wet Tamale.» This is a burrito or a tamale swimming in a delicious enchilada type of sauce. You sop up your burrito or tamale in the sauce. It makes for a wonderful meal and it only costs around $ 4. The old saying«you can’t judge a book by it’s cover» certainly applies to Martha’s Tacos & More. In Martha’s case the cover doesn’t look that great but the contents are so delicious and inexpensive.
